    Taschenbuch. Zustand: Neu. Neuware - 'Modern Aladdins and Their Magic' is an engaging exploration into the origins and production of the everyday objects that define modern life. Written to spark curiosity and wonder, this work delves into the fascinating industrial processes and scientific principles behind common household items, tools, and technologies. By framing the advancements of the early 20th century as a form of modern-day sorcery, the text guides readers through the 'magic' of manufacturing, from the creation of paper and glass to the complexities of machinery and electricity.Through clear explanations and a focus on the ingenuity of human invention, the book demystifies the world of industry for a general audience. It serves as a comprehensive primer on how raw materials are transformed into the finished products we often take for granted. This classic work stands as a testament to the era's optimism regarding technological progress and remains a charming historical survey of the craftsmanship and science that built the foundations of the contemporary world.
